Lithuania — physical cross-border flows, 2026
Every month of the year, every border, in energy and in money. Flows are measured; each megawatt-hour is valued at Lithuania's own day-ahead price for the quarter-hour it actually crossed in.

Consumption is measured separately, as the hourly average power summed over the month — not by adding up readings, since sources publish at different rates. The last column puts imports next to it for scale; it is not a dependency figure, because part of what enters passes straight through to another neighbour.

Gross volumes differ by design: the official indicators include transits, and a transit is counted once entering and once leaving, while a physical border sees it only once. Net figures converge, because transits cancel out — which is why the comparison is made on the net.
ANRE publishes these exchanges as a physical balance in GWh. It publishes no import or export value and no average price per direction, so no money comparison is possible.
Physical cross-border flows and commercial electricity trades measure different phenomena. ANRE data is shown as an independent official benchmark and should not be interpreted as an exact reconciliation.

Method
Not an invoice. Cross-border electricity is not sold country to country: the markets are coupled and the physical flow is the outcome of a shared auction. These figures value the measured flow at this zone's own day-ahead price, so both directions can be compared on the same scale.
Flows are measured, quarter-hour by quarter-hour; hourly borders are spread across the four quarters they cover, so every megawatt-hour meets the price that was actually in force. Energy entering the country is not the same as energy consumed here — some of it passes through.
A country between two others carries energy that is neither produced nor consumed there. Energy entering is not energy used.
